The Report of a Committee of One is a historical book published in 1880, written by a committee of one person. The book is focused on the official life and administrations of William S. Stokley, who served as the Mayor of the City of Philadelphia during the late 19th century. The book provides an in-depth analysis of Stokley's political career, his policies, and his impact on the city of Philadelphia during his tenure as the mayor. The author of the book has conducted extensive research and has gathered information from various sources to provide a comprehensive view of Stokley's life and career.
